I am almost two weeks post op. I had my slipped band and port removed and converted to RNY. I am still in so much pain. OMG. It is wearing me down. I actually cried tonight. Up now with pain. 

I am not a wimp. Have children and have sailed through another major surgery but this is the most pain I've ever been in. Went to post op appointment and they took out staples and said pain was to be expected. 

I have seen where others are experiencing little to no pain. I am so happy for them, however that's not what I am experiencing.

I have horrible lower left back pain (around kidney area). Has anyone else had that. What's it from? Aprreciate any responses! ð??'

When will all this begin to subside? 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Did you have band removed and RNY done in one operation??  That is alot at one time.  The few people I knew who did this, waited weeks or months between band removal and the RNY surgery. But I don't know enough about revision to say if one way is better than other.

You have been through a lot, but that much pain two weeks out does not sound good.  Can you make it until Tues when dr office is open again, if you can't, call and use their emergency number or you can go to ER at hosp where you had surgery done.

The pain could be related or unrelated, so you really need to get it checked out.

All I can do is give you my experience . I also heard everyone just having gas and some discomfort when they woke up from surgery, I had my lapband for 6.5 years and on May 3 ( 4 weeks ago ) I went in for my revision to remove my band and do my rny in one procedure. While my dr was in there he found a mass on my intestines and had to dissect it off. It ended up being nothing to worry over but that added some time to anesthesia , which added more co2 gas, then my band tubing was under and behind my liver and that took a little longer to remove. I opened my eyes in horror at the emence pain that I was not expecting. I also am not a wimp. I have had 2 births and a cesarean with my twins and never complained.with my revision  Day 1 was very rough, day 2 was a lot better and day 3 I went home just a tad sore and tired . Day 4 I was off pain medicine and only took 5 nausea pills after that . I do not know but my feeling is that something is just not right with you hurting for 2 weeks. I was on my own with my kids by day 4 and I'm concerned that you have a problem going on. Please insist your dr sees you .
